1. Master the Basics
Before diving into advanced tactics, it’s crucial to master the basic skills of soccer. This includes dribbling, passing, shooting, and defending. Spend time practicing these skills individually. Use cones to improve your dribbling, practice passing with a partner, and shoot at targets to enhance your accuracy. Consistent practice of these fundamentals will build a solid foundation for your game.
2. Understand the Game Tactics
Soccer is as much about strategy as it is about physical ability. Understanding different formations and tactics can significantly improve your gameplay. Familiarize yourself with common formations such as 4-4-2, 4-3-3, and 3-5-2. Each formation has its strengths and weaknesses, and knowing how to adapt your play style to these formations is key. Additionally, studying how professional teams play can provide valuable insights into effective strategies.
3. Improve Your Fitness Level
Soccer requires a high level of fitness due to the constant movement and endurance needed during a match. Incorporate fitness training into your routine, focusing on cardiovascular endurance, strength training, and flexibility. Running, cycling, and swimming are excellent ways to build cardiovascular fitness. Strength training can be done using bodyweight exercises or weights to improve your power and agility on the field.
4. Develop Mental Toughness
Soccer is as much a mental game as it is a physical one. Developing mental toughness can help you stay focused and resilient during matches. Techniques such as visualization, goal setting, and mindfulness can improve your mental game. Visualize yourself successfully executing plays, set realistic goals for your performance, and practice mindfulness to stay present during the game.
5. Communication is Key
Effective communication with teammates can make a significant difference in your performance. Always be vocal on the field, calling for the ball and giving instructions. It’s important to establish a good rapport with your teammates, as this can lead to better teamwork and coordination during matches. Practice drills that require communication to build this skill.
6. Study the Game
Watching soccer matches can provide invaluable lessons. Pay attention to how professional players position themselves, their decision-making processes, and their tactical awareness. Analyze games to understand how different teams adapt their strategies against various opponents. This knowledge can be applied to your own gameplay.
